Abstract:With growing interest in using alternative and complementary medicine, especially medicinal plants, because of low cost and less adverse effects. This study was performed to evaluate the anti-hyperthyroidism effects of medicinal herb, chestnut (Castanea sativa mill) that used to enrich yoghurt with different premixes on levothyroxine (LT4)-induced hyperthyroidism rats.
